ABOUT US

An ASX100 business with a 50-year heritage, IDP is a global leader in international education services. We’ve been operating for 50 years with a global office network spanning over 100 offices and our websites attract a combined 100 million visits a year.

Our team of experienced and dedicated counsellors are experts at providing trusted advice to students and their families at every step of the international education journey, and almost 8 in 10 students placed by IDP recommend our services to their family and friends.

IDP is building a global, connected marketplace that guides international students into the life and career of their dreams. IDP co-owns IELTS, which supports test-takers’ study, migration, and professional ambitions. We not only jointly provide the IELTS test, we help test-takers prepare and gain confidence through IELTS support tools and guidance.
